    OSLO, Feb 7 (Reuters) - Norwegian soldiers in the NATO-led mission in Afghanistan were attacked on Tuesday by a crowd throwing stones and which smashed their way into the force's camp, Norway's defence ministry said. The attack occurred three days after Norway's embassy in Syria was torched by Muslim demonstrators angry at the publication of cartoons of the Prophet Mohammad in Danish and Norwegian newspapers. Two Norwegians were reported slightly hurt in the attack by about 200-300 demonstrators at the Meymaneh camp of the ISAF international peace force, a ministry spokesman said.     KABUL (AP) - Thousands of rioters clashed with police and NATO peacekeepers across Afghanistan on Tuesday in demonstrations against the publication of cartoons of the Prophet Muhammad, officials said. One person was killed and scores wounded. Norwegian troops fired on hundreds of protesters outside their base in Maymana, a city in the northwest, after the demonstrators shot at them and threw grenades, said provincial Gov. Mohammed Latif. One of the demonstrators was shot dead while two others were wounded, he said.
